#957c61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#957c61 is composed of 58.4% red, 48.6%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 34.9%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 31.2 degrees, a saturation of 21.1% and a lightness of 48.2%. #957c61 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8c2 with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#957c61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#957c61 has RGB values of R:149, G:124,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.35,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9796705.
